I hate to say this, but on my home (Mac) and work (HP PC) computers, whenever I misspell a word, a red line appears under it. I don't have to do anything - it just happens. If I don't know how to spell it correctly, I just "Control"-Click over it (Mac) or "Right Click" over it (PC), and a list of words I might have intended pops up.
I believe that all of the popular browsers now have this feature - Opera, FireFox, Safari, and Chrome. Well, all of them except Explorer...
